Race Work with Dr. Lori Watson

MUSD has partnered with Dr. Lori Watson to develop a series of trainings for staff, parents and students. Dr. Watson launched her first training will all MUSD employees on September 16th. This introductory training laid the foundation for our collective anti-racist work as a district.
Dr. Watson will be working with a cohort of MUSD staff for three intensive training in October. Their work together will take a deeper dive into bias and ways to interrupt systematic racism.
We have also scheduled a six-part parent series that began in December. Parents/Families are welcome to partcicipate in any sessions.
